Introduction

Middle East distribution transformer market is small as compared to other regions in the world however it is important to note that there is a lot movement in the market currently.
This is because the region has starting focusing on increasing its renewable energy capacity and diversifying its economy.
Furthermore, there are several plans to add MVA capacity in the grid to meet the growing demand for electricity.
The market is emerging as a key demand instigator for distribution transformers.
